Premature birth, also known as preterm birth, occurs when a baby is born before 37 weeks of pregnancy are completed. A normal pregnancy typically lasts about 40 weeks, and babies born prematurely may face various health challenges due to incomplete development. Understanding the signs and symptoms associated with premature babies is crucial for parents and caregivers to provide appropriate care and seek timely medical attention.
Premature babies often display distinctive physical and developmental characteristics that differ from full-term infants. The degree of prematurity significantly affects which symptoms appear and their severity. While medical advances have greatly improved outcomes for premature infants, recognizing these signs early can help ensure proper monitoring and intervention when necessary.
1. Low Birth Weight
One of the most noticeable signs of a premature baby is significantly low birth weight. Most premature infants weigh less than 5 pounds, 8 ounces (2,500 grams), with some extremely premature babies weighing less than 2 pounds, 3 ounces (1,000 grams).
The low birth weight results from the baby not having enough time in the womb to accumulate the necessary fat stores and reach optimal growth. This can make premature babies appear thin and fragile, with visible veins through their translucent skin. Low birth weight babies require special attention to nutrition and temperature regulation, as they have difficulty maintaining body heat and need additional calories to support catch-up growth.
2. Small Size and Disproportionate Body Features
Premature babies typically appear much smaller than full-term infants, with a disproportionately large head compared to their body. Their head may account for a larger percentage of their total body length because the brain develops earlier than other body parts during fetal development.
These babies often have thin limbs with little muscle tone or fat padding underneath their skin. Their features may appear sharp rather than the rounded, fuller appearance of term babies. The overall small size and unusual proportions are direct results of incomplete gestational development and will gradually normalize as the baby grows and matures.
3. Thin, Transparent, or Fragile-Looking Skin
The skin of a premature baby is often noticeably thin, shiny, and translucent, allowing you to see blood vessels beneath the surface. This occurs because the layers of skin haven’t fully developed, and there’s minimal subcutaneous fat beneath the skin.
The skin may appear reddish or pink due to the visible blood vessels and may be covered with fine, soft hair called lanugo. This downy hair normally disappears before full-term birth but remains visible on premature infants. The skin may also appear wrinkled and lack the smooth, plump appearance of full-term babies. Additionally, premature babies’ skin is more sensitive and vulnerable to damage, requiring gentle handling and specialized care products.
4. Breathing Difficulties (Respiratory Distress)
Respiratory problems are among the most serious and common symptoms in premature babies. These infants may exhibit rapid, shallow, or irregular breathing patterns, along with grunting sounds, flaring nostrils, and visible chest retractions where the skin pulls in around the ribs with each breath.
The breathing difficulties occur because the lungs are among the last organs to fully mature during pregnancy. Premature babies often lack sufficient surfactant, a substance that keeps the tiny air sacs in the lungs from collapsing. This can lead to respiratory distress syndrome (RDS), a serious condition requiring medical intervention. Some premature infants may experience apnea, which is characterized by pauses in breathing lasting more than 20 seconds. These respiratory challenges typically necessitate monitoring and sometimes breathing support in a neonatal intensive care unit.
5. Feeding Difficulties and Weak Sucking Reflex
Premature babies frequently struggle with feeding due to an underdeveloped or weak sucking reflex. They may tire easily during feeding attempts, fall asleep before consuming adequate amounts, or have difficulty coordinating sucking, swallowing, and breathing simultaneously.
These feeding challenges stem from immature neurological development and insufficient muscle strength. Many premature infants cannot breastfeed or bottle-feed effectively and may require alternative feeding methods, such as tube feeding, until they develop the necessary skills. Poor feeding can lead to inadequate nutrition and slow weight gain, making proper feeding support essential for premature babies. Parents may notice their baby taking very small amounts of milk, requiring frequent feedings, or showing signs of fatigue after just a few minutes of attempting to feed.
6. Temperature Regulation Problems
Premature babies have significant difficulty maintaining their body temperature, a condition known as hypothermia risk. These infants lose heat rapidly and struggle to generate sufficient warmth on their own, often feeling cool or cold to the touch even in a warm environment.
The inability to regulate temperature effectively occurs due to several factors: minimal body fat for insulation, a large surface area relative to body mass, immature skin that doesn’t provide adequate protection, and an underdeveloped hypothalamus (the brain’s temperature control center). Premature babies typically require incubators or radiant warmers that provide carefully controlled environmental temperatures. Parents may notice their premature baby needs to wear a hat even indoors, requires extra layers or blankets, and needs a consistently warm environment to remain comfortable and stable.
7. Reduced Physical Activity and Low Muscle Tone
Premature infants often display noticeably reduced physical activity and low muscle tone, medically termed hypotonia. They may appear floppy or limp when held, with limbs that seem to hang loosely rather than maintaining the flexed position typical of full-term newborns.
The baby might move less frequently or with less vigor than expected, and their movements may appear weak or uncoordinated. This reduced muscle tone affects their ability to maintain posture, hold their head up, or demonstrate the strong grasping reflex seen in term babies. The hypotonia results from incomplete neuromuscular development and typically improves gradually as the nervous system matures. In the meantime, these babies may need specialized positioning and gentle exercises to support their developing muscle strength and coordination.
8. Jaundice (Yellowing of Skin and Eyes)
Jaundice, characterized by a yellowish discoloration of the skin and the whites of the eyes, is particularly common and often more severe in premature babies. This condition results from elevated levels of bilirubin, a yellow pigment produced when red blood cells break down.
Premature infants are more susceptible to jaundice because their immature livers cannot efficiently process and eliminate bilirubin from their bloodstream. Additionally, premature babies may have difficulty feeding adequately, which can slow the elimination of bilirubin through stool. While mild jaundice is common in many newborns, premature babies may develop more pronounced yellowing that appears earlier and lasts longer. The jaundice may start on the face and progress downward to the chest, abdomen, and extremities. High bilirubin levels require monitoring and potentially intervention to prevent complications.
9. Underdeveloped Reflexes
Premature babies typically exhibit weak or absent reflexes that are normally present and strong in full-term infants. These reflexes include the rooting reflex (turning toward touch on the cheek), sucking reflex, grasping reflex, and Moro reflex (startle response).
The underdevelopment of these primitive reflexes indicates that the nervous system hasn’t reached full maturity. Parents may notice their premature baby doesn’t automatically turn their head when their cheek is stroked, has a weak grip when something is placed in their palm, or doesn’t show the expected startle response to sudden movements or loud noises. The gag reflex may also be immature, increasing the risk of feeding-related complications. These reflexes typically strengthen and become more pronounced as the baby’s neurological system continues to develop and mature over time.
10. Irregular Heart Rate and Blood Pressure
Premature infants often experience irregularities in heart rate and blood pressure that require careful monitoring. They may have episodes of bradycardia (abnormally slow heart rate, typically below 100 beats per minute) or tachycardia (abnormally fast heart rate).
These cardiovascular irregularities occur because the autonomic nervous system, which regulates automatic body functions including heart rate, is not fully developed. Bradycardia episodes often occur alongside apnea (breathing pauses) and may cause the baby’s skin to appear pale or bluish. Blood pressure in premature babies may be unstable or lower than normal, affecting blood flow to vital organs. These cardiovascular symptoms typically require continuous monitoring in a neonatal intensive care unit, where medical staff can quickly respond to any concerning changes and ensure the baby’s heart and circulatory system are functioning adequately.
Main Causes of Premature Birth
Understanding the causes of premature birth can help identify risk factors and potentially prevent preterm delivery in future pregnancies. While sometimes the exact cause remains unknown, several factors are associated with increased risk of premature birth:
- Previous Premature Birth: Women who have had a previous premature delivery are at higher risk of experiencing another preterm birth in subsequent pregnancies.
- Multiple Pregnancies: Carrying twins, triplets, or more babies significantly increases the likelihood of premature birth due to increased uterine stretching and other physiological stresses.
- Cervical or Uterine Problems: Structural abnormalities of the uterus or an incompetent cervix (one that begins to open too early) can lead to premature labor.
- Chronic Health Conditions: Maternal health issues such as high blood pressure, diabetes, kidney disease, or blood clotting disorders can increase premature birth risk.
- Infections: Certain infections of the amniotic fluid, urinary tract, vagina, or sexually transmitted infections can trigger premature labor.
- Poor Prenatal Care: Inadequate or absent prenatal care prevents early detection and management of risk factors for premature birth.
- Lifestyle Factors: Smoking, alcohol consumption, illicit drug use, high stress levels, and poor nutrition during pregnancy are associated with increased preterm birth risk.
- Short Interval Between Pregnancies: Becoming pregnant again within six months of delivering a baby increases the risk of premature birth.
- Maternal Age: Teenage mothers and women over 35 years old face higher risks of premature delivery.
- Complications During Pregnancy: Conditions such as preeclampsia, placenta previa, placental abruption, or too much or too little amniotic fluid can necessitate early delivery or trigger premature labor.
Prevention of Premature Birth
While not all premature births can be prevented, several strategies can reduce the risk and improve outcomes for both mother and baby:
Receive Regular Prenatal Care: Attending all scheduled prenatal appointments allows healthcare providers to monitor the pregnancy closely, identify potential problems early, and intervene when necessary. Early and consistent prenatal care is one of the most effective ways to reduce premature birth risk.
Maintain a Healthy Lifestyle: Adopting healthy habits before and during pregnancy significantly reduces risk. This includes eating a balanced, nutritious diet rich in fruits, vegetables, whole grains, and lean proteins; maintaining a healthy weight; staying physically active with appropriate exercises; and ensuring adequate rest.
Avoid Harmful Substances: Completely eliminate smoking, alcohol consumption, and recreational drug use during pregnancy. These substances directly increase the risk of premature birth and cause other serious complications.
Manage Chronic Health Conditions: Women with pre-existing medical conditions such as diabetes, high blood pressure, or thyroid disorders should work closely with their healthcare providers to keep these conditions well-controlled before and throughout pregnancy.
Space Pregnancies Appropriately: Waiting at least 18 months between giving birth and conceiving again allows the body to fully recover and reduces the risk of premature birth in subsequent pregnancies.
Address Infections Promptly: Seek medical attention for any signs of infection during pregnancy, including urinary tract infections, vaginal infections, or other illnesses. Prompt treatment can prevent these infections from triggering premature labor.
Reduce Stress: High stress levels have been linked to premature birth. Practice stress-reduction techniques such as meditation, gentle exercise, adequate sleep, and seeking support from family, friends, or mental health professionals when needed.
Monitor Warning Signs: Learn to recognize the signs of premature labor, including regular or frequent contractions, pelvic pressure, low backache, vaginal bleeding or fluid leakage, and changes in vaginal discharge. Contact a healthcare provider immediately if any of these symptoms occur.
Consider Progesterone Supplementation: For women with a history of premature birth or a short cervix, healthcare providers may recommend progesterone supplementation during pregnancy, which has been shown to reduce the risk of recurrent preterm birth. This should only be used under medical supervision.
Frequently Asked Questions
What is considered a premature baby?
A premature baby is one born before 37 completed weeks of pregnancy. Premature births are further categorized into late preterm (34-36 weeks), moderately preterm (32-34 weeks), very preterm (28-32 weeks), and extremely preterm (before 28 weeks). The earlier a baby is born, the higher the risk of complications and the more pronounced the symptoms of prematurity.
Can premature babies develop normally?
Yes, many premature babies can develop normally and catch up to their full-term peers, though the timeline varies depending on how early they were born. With advances in neonatal care, the majority of premature babies, especially those born after 32 weeks, grow up healthy with no long-term complications. Some may experience developmental delays initially but often catch up within the first few years of life. Regular follow-up care and early intervention services when needed can support optimal development.
How long do premature babies typically stay in the hospital?
The length of hospital stay depends primarily on the baby’s gestational age at birth and overall health status. Late preterm babies (34-36 weeks) may only need a few days to a couple of weeks, while babies born before 32 weeks typically remain hospitalized until around their original due date or when they can breathe independently, maintain body temperature, and feed adequately without assistance. Extremely premature babies may require several months of hospital care.
Do all premature babies need to be in an incubator?
Not all premature babies require incubators, but most do, especially those born before 34 weeks. Incubators provide a controlled environment that maintains optimal temperature, humidity, and sometimes oxygen levels. Late preterm babies who can regulate their temperature adequately may not need an incubator and might be able to use an open crib with warm blankets instead. The need for an incubator is determined by the baby’s ability to maintain stable body temperature and other vital functions.
What is the survival rate for premature babies?
Survival rates for premature babies have improved dramatically with modern medical care. Babies born at 28 weeks or later have survival rates exceeding 90-95%. Those born between 24-28 weeks have survival rates of 50-80%, depending on the specific gestational age and access to specialized neonatal intensive care. Babies born before 24 weeks face more significant challenges with lower survival rates. The survival rate improves with each additional week of gestation.
Are premature babies more susceptible to health problems later in life?
Premature babies, particularly those born very early, may have increased risks for certain health issues as they grow. These can include chronic lung disease, vision and hearing problems, developmental delays, learning difficulties, and in some cases, cerebral palsy. However, many premature babies grow up without any long-term health problems. The risk of complications decreases significantly the closer to term the baby is born. Regular medical follow-ups and early interventions can help address potential issues and improve long-term outcomes.
When should I seek immediate medical attention for a premature baby?
You should seek immediate medical attention if your premature baby shows signs of breathing difficulties (gasping, turning blue, or pauses in breathing), becomes unresponsive or extremely lethargic, refuses to eat for multiple feedings, has a rectal temperature below 97°F (36.1°C) or above 100.4°F (38°C), shows signs of infection such as unusual irritability or lethargy, or has fewer wet diapers than expected. Additionally, if you notice the baby’s skin becoming increasingly yellow (jaundice), seems to be in pain, or displays any other concerning symptoms, contact your healthcare provider promptly.
